The year was 1865 and in the heart of the Arthur’s Pass National Park the Otira Stagecoach Hotel was constructed to meet the growing needs of the gold mining industry and ever increasing population growth. Restoring this grand old lady to original is the passion and dream of the staff and builders. Antiques throughout the hotel and outside many stagecoaches and horse wagons, The hotel is recognised as a museum and there is so much to see, as every room and corner is filled with antiques and bric a brac from the past. Eight rooms, each with their own unique furniture of the era. High beds with valve radios, patterned toilets and hand-basins and beautifully restored ornate furniture. Taxidermy, Quirky oddities and vintage curiosities are scattered around the hotel, on shelves and in display cases.
Then there’s the resident spooks that make themselves known from time to time. Visiting mediums have picked up on them; staff and those staying a night or two have encountered them.
